Science: Biology
Biology is a vast field that encompasses various sub-disciplines and areas of study. Some of the key subtopics in biology include:
Biochemistry
Biochemistry is the study of the chemical processes within living organisms, focusing on the interactions between proteins, lipids, carbohydrates, and nucleic acids.
Biophysics
Biophysics combines physics and biology to understand the physical principles underlying biological processes, such as cellular processes and molecular interactions.
Cell Biology (Cytology)
Cell biology is the study of cells, their structure, function, and interactions within living organisms.
Genetics
Genetics is the study of heredity and variation in organisms, including the transfer of traits from one generation to the next.
Molecular Genetics
Molecular genetics focuses on the study of genetic molecules, such as DNA and RNA, and their role in encoding and transmitting genetic information.
Evolutionary Biology
Evolutionary biology examines the mechanisms of evolution, including natural selection, genetic drift, and gene flow, and how they shape the diversity of life on Earth.
Ecology
Ecology is the study of the relationships between organisms and their environment, as well as the interactions between organisms and each other.
Marine Biology
Marine biology is the study of life in aquatic environments, including marine plants, animals, and microorganisms.
Systematics / Taxonomy
Systematics and taxonomy are the study of classifying and categorizing organisms based on their shared characteristics and evolutionary relationships.
Population Genetics
Population genetics is the study of genetic variation within and between populations, and how genetic changes occur over time.
Microbiology
Microbiology is the study of microorganisms, including bacteria, archaea, and viruses, and their interactions with the environment and other organisms.
Virology
Virology is the study of viruses, their structure, and their interactions with host organisms.
Botany
Botany is the study of plants, including their structure, function, and interactions with the environment.
Zoology
Zoology is the study of animals, including their structure, function, and interactions with the environment.
